CNN: US, Iran discussing return to pre-conflict status quo

The first stage of a potential peace agreement between Iran and the United States could involve both sides returning to the status quo before the conflict began.

Axar.az informs, citing CNN, that although the second round of talks has not yet taken place, the two sides "are not as far apart as they seem."

Intense diplomacy continues behind the scenes, the sources say, and ongoing talks are centered around a staged process in which the first part of a potential deal would focus on returning to the status quo before the war and reopening the Strait of Hormuz without restrictions or tolls.

The issue of Iran’s nuclear program – which both the US and Israel cited as their casus belli – would be addressed later.

According to the sources, mediators are applying pressure on both sides to reach an agreement, with the next few days being especially crucial. Hanging over it all is the chance that the US may decide to disengage and return to war.
